What is the Student Medical History and Physical Exam Form?
The Student Medical History and Physical Exam Form serves a critical purpose by documenting the health history of student athletes. This form is essential for assessing whether students are ready and safe to participate in sports activities. Educational institutions, particularly in California, typically require this form as part of their health and safety protocols.

Key Features of the Student Medical History and Physical Exam Form
The form consists of various key sections which include:
-
Medical conditions and prior injuries
-
Allergies and medication information
-
Family medical history to identify hereditary risks
-
Emergency contact details
Additionally, it requires signatures from the student, parent or guardian, and a physician, verifying that all parties acknowledge the information is accurate and complete. This ensures the physical exam form is not only a submission of data but a collaborative effort in safeguarding the athlete's health.
Who Needs the Student Medical History and Physical Exam Form?
All student athletes, regardless of their level of competition, are required to complete the form. Specific groups include students participating in school-sponsored sports teams, intramural sports, and any athletic programs organized by educational institutions. Age considerations such as maturity and independence may dictate whether a parent or guardian must co-sign the form.
